Mechanism of action

The combination acts primarly by suppressing ovulation through feedback inhibition of gonadotropins, while also altering cervical mucus and the endometrium to prevent fertilisation.

Pregnancy and breastfeeding

Pregnancy: Contraindicated; stop immediately if pregnancy occurs. Breastfeeding: May reduce milk volume.
